White Out (Original Poem)

image

A fractured perception of self.
A relentless assault of
Numbing shards
Formed in the wake
Of another's indifference.

The mind gives way.
The body crumbles.
A vessel drained and shattered,
Lies in wait,
Wrapped in frozen serenity.

A warming amnesia
Courses through hollow veins.
Failures slip away.
Consciousness slows,
The breath turns pale.
